Features

  • fabric
  • Imported
  • Double Utility, One PriceIncludes 2 machine-washable mattress covers: 1Rugged waterproof cover with TPU waterproof membrane for camping/tent use, and 2soft Knitted cotton cover ideal for guest beds/home comfort.
  • CertiPUR-US Memory Foam Inner CoreHigh-density base foam prevents sagging, pressure-relieving memory foam adapts to body shape, airflow layer reduces heat. NO MORE back pain or annoying discomfort from rocky terrain from Willpo sleeping pad.
  • Waterproof & Anti-Slip DesignThe outdoor camping mat is covered with TPU film to improve waterproof performance. Black non-slip bottom of camping tent mattress is suitable for grass, gravel floor, hard floor or tiles.
  • Hygienic & Easy to CleanBoth covers of memory foam pad are sterile and can be removed and machine washed.
  • Comes with a Travel BagPortable sleeping pad with a travel bag is ready to use in seconds for car camping, sleepovers, or emergency home use.

  • Good Mattress, Don’t love accessories
I’ve spent about 14 nights on this mattress. The mattress itself is comfortable. It’s not as nice as sleeping on your bed at home but that’s to be expected. It’s definitely better when used on a cot but still really beats an inflatable mattress when directly on the floor of my tent. Why not 5 stars? The “outdoor” cover is some sort of microfiber that really traps heat. I look forward to this for cooler weather camping but it’s too much in the summer. The “indoor” cover is better for warm nights but it doesn’t have the compression straps like the “outdoor” cover so it has to be put on and taken off in the tent, which I find inconvenient. I’ve seen reviews saying the pillow was understuffed but mine is WAY overstuffed and quite uncomfortable. I’d pitch it but it’s an OK backup in case I forget to bring a better pillow. It’s also made of that very warm material. This product also loses point for the bag. It has begun to tear where the the straps are attached. I do like the mattress and will try to find some other cover materials for it and just pack my own compression straps. I’ll try repairing the bag with tent repair tape. So while it’s not perfect, it does the job. ... show more

My husband and I along with our young son do a big camping trip every year. My husband and I are in our early 40s with very typical achy joints, he's an athletic build and I'm a bit extra fluffy. We purchased 3 of these mattresses and we've used them several times for backyard camp outs and recently took them for a week long trip to northern Wisconsin and Michigan's Upper Peninsula. Night time lows got down to 46 but mostly stayed in the low 50s. We have a 4/5 person tent which we put a heavy duty tarp under. We used 2 self inflating air mattresses and 1 accordion style foam pad under these mattresses. Let's be real, the air mattress & foam pad act as a moisture & temperature barrier, they're not for comfort. When we put the 3 mattresses together they're roughly the size of a king size mattress. It was a tight fit in our tent but it worked! Rather than rely on the velcro we put a king size fitted sheet over it all to hold it together which worked great. We then used our sleeping bags & pillows on top of the mattress. We spent a full week sleeping with this set up and we were very comfortable. We did move from one campground to another. Packing these up is easy and the bags they come with are more than big enough. We packed them in the back of a truck and experienced some light rain. The bags are definitely water resistant and although the mattresses didn't stay perfectly dry they stayed mostly dry and were completely usable that night. I'll admit, they started out pretty stiff but with use they get softer. We woke up each morning of our recent without too many aches and pains. We originally only had 2 of these but our son sleeps between us when we camp and it was awkward to have a ditch in the middle. Having 3 evens out the surface and we all sleep comfortably. There was one night where it was pretty warm at night. We all got too warm but these mattresses don't seem to hold the heat. Overall they're a great solution for those of us who can't handle cold hard ground as a sleep surface but aren't ready to give up our tents for motels or an RV. I believe they're going to last us for years to come. ... show more
